EDU289AB: Secondary Mathematics Methods and Curriculum Development
– 2 credits
Overview and practical application of mathematics teaching methodology and curriculum development for secondary teachers. Teaching strategies and learning styles covered. Curriculum design, lesson objectives, time management skills, teaching resources and student assessment also included. Professional Teaching Standards emphasized. Includes current research findings related to the application and learning of secondary mathematics content. Note: EDU289AB requires an approved field experience. Prerequisites: Baccalaureate Degree and formal admission to a state approved post-baccalaureate teacher preparation program. Prerequisites or Corequisites: EDU289.
